1、保證我們拿到的是最新代碼:
svn update
假設最新版本號是28。
2、然后找出要回滾的確切版本號:
svn log
假設根據svn log日志查出要回滾的版本號是25,此處的something可以是文件、目錄或整個項目
如果想要更詳細的了解情況,可以使用svn diff -r 28:25 ""
3、回滾到版本號25:
svn merge -r 28:25 ""
為了保險起見,再次確認回滾的結果:
svn diff ""
發現正確無誤,提交。
4、提交回滾:
svn commit -m "Revert revision from r28 to r25,because of ..."
提交后版本變成了29。